Security Policy

Supported Versions

Version Supported
2.x Yes
1.x No

Reporting a Vulnerability

If you discover a security vulnerability in LLMix, do not open a public GitHub issue.

Report it privately via GitHub Security Advisories or email the maintainers directly.

Please include:

  • A description of the vulnerability and its potential impact
  • Steps to reproduce
  • Affected versions

You can expect an acknowledgment within 48 hours and a resolution timeline within 14 days for confirmed vulnerabilities.

Scope

LLMix handles API keys and routes LLM provider traffic. Security-relevant areas include:

  • Key pool (key_pool.py, key-pool.ts) — API key rotation and dead-key marking. Keys are held in memory; they are never written to disk by the library.
  • Kill switch — filesystem-based state stored in LLMIX_STATE_DIR, XDG_STATE_HOME/llmix, or ~/.local/state/llmix by default. Directory permissions are the caller's responsibility.
  • File lock (resilience.py, resilience.ts) — cross-process lock file. Uses proper-lockfile in TypeScript and fcntl in Python.
  • Provider dispatch — the dispatch callback is caller-supplied. The library does not validate or sanitize provider responses.
  • Cache keys — SHA-256 of canonical JSON with the llmix:resp: prefix. Cache contents are stored as-is, including <think> blocks. Redis L2 cache security is the caller's responsibility.
